The Latgale neighbourhood of is situated on the right bank of the Daugava River, located to the south of . Until 2024, the neighbourhood was named Maskavas forštate, and was also known as Maskavas priekšpilsēta and colloquially as Maskačka—a name derived from the road historically connecting Riga to .
